"The majority of mobile phone addiction predicted subsequent mental health symptoms, especially inability to control cravings, productivity loss, and anxiety."
"it revealed a temporal link between productivity loss and anxiety for females, whereas for males, it highlighted inability to control cravings and academic stress."
"These findings supplement the longitudinal evidence from a psychometric perspective, revealing the complex network interactions between mobile phone addiction and mental health, and highlighting the key associations between gendered mobile phone use and psychological problems as intervention targets."
Temporal relationships between mobile phone addiction and mental health: A longitudinal network analysis study from non-clinical adolescents.
